AMD Turion II P560
The AMD Turion II Dual-Core P560 ist a mobile laptop processor with two cores. It is based on the desktop Athlon II processors (due to the missing level 3 cache) and offers an integrated DDR3-1066 memory controller. The connection to the chipset is done with a single 16-Bit HyperTransport 3.0 link clocked at 1800MHz (3600MHz effective). Compared to the similar Turion N530, the P560 is specified at a lower TDP of 25 versus 35 Watt.
Compared to Intel Core 2 Duo processors at that clock range, the Turion II offers less cache and is therefore slower. Furthermore, comparing two CPUs with the same amount of cache, the Intel CPUs are still a bit faster (by 100 MHz on the average).
With 32 Watt TDP, the CPU is intended for mid sized laptops with a display size of 13-inches and larger.
